General introduction to FM200 system
What is FM200?
FM200 or HFC-227ea (heptafluoropropane) is a clean fire extinguishing gas, widely used in modern fire protection systems. FM200 gas has many outstanding advantages compared to traditional fire extinguishing agents such as CO2 or N2 gas.
Main features of FM200:
- FM200 gas works by absorbing heat and preventing the chemical reaction of the combustion process, helping to extinguish the fire without removing oxygen from the environment.
- The ability to spray gas and extinguish the fire within just 10 seconds, significantly reducing damage.
- This gas is non-conductive and does not leave any residue after discharge, is safe for sensitive electronic devices and is not dangerous to humans at standard levels.
Trends in using clean gas in modern fire fighting
In the context of developing technology and increasing awareness of safety and environment, traditional fire fighting systems such as CO2 or dry powder are gradually being replaced by clean gas fire fighting systems (clean agent). This is an inevitable trend in the modern fire fighting industry globally and in Vietnam.
Clean gas such as FM200, Novec 1230, IG-541, IG-100 (inert gas)... does not cause suffocation, does not occupy much oxygen in the air at the design concentration. Therefore, it can be used in spaces with people while still ensuring safety when activating the system.
Unlike dry powder or CO2 which can easily cause thermal shock and corrosion, clean gas does not leave residue, does not damage electrical and electronic equipment. This is why they are preferred for use in:
- Server rooms, data centers
- Control rooms, UPS
- Data storage, documents, museums...
Modern clean gas lines such as FM200, Novec 1230 all meet the standard of not destroying the ozone layer (ODP = 0), comply with the Montreal Protocol and NFPA 2001.

Structure of the FM200 fire extinguishing system
FM200 gas cylinder
FM200 gas cylinder is an indispensable component in the automatic fire extinguishing system, especially for areas with high safety requirements such as: data centers, server rooms, computer rooms, laboratories,... FM200 fire extinguishers have become the first choice of many businesses with the ability to extinguish fires quickly, effectively and safely.
Structure and operating principle:
- The cylinder body is designed to withstand high pressure to keep the gas in a compressed liquid form, helping to save space and increase spray efficiency. The material is usually stainless steel or high-strength alloy, ensuring durability and safety during storage.
- FM200 gas: a clean, colorless, odorless gas that can absorb heat and reduce oxygen concentration.
- Safety valve helps prevent the pressure in the tank from being too high.
- Pressure gauge helps monitor the pressure level in the tank.
- The connection to the pipeline system helps to conduct gas from the tank to the nozzles located in the protected area. The pipeline and nozzles are designed to ensure that the gas spreads evenly, extinguishing the fire quickly.
- Exhaust pipe has the effect of conducting gas to the nozzles.
Piping system
The pipeline system helps to carry gas from the tank to the nozzles, ensuring that the fire extinguishing gas is transmitted to the correct location and quickly extinguishes the fire.
Pipes are often made of materials that can withstand high pressure, corrosion and high temperatures such as:
- Stainless steel: is the most popular material, has high durability, good corrosion resistance.
- Copper: has good heat conduction, often used in special locations.
Structure and function:
- The main pipe connects directly from the tank to the auxiliary pipe branches, which are the largest diameter pipes.
- Auxiliary pipes: are smaller branches, branching from the main pipe, carrying FM200 gas to areas that need protection.
- The nozzle is the final device of the pipe system, with the task of dispersing gas into small jets, covering the fire area evenly.
Nozzles
The nozzle is an important part of the FM200 system, which is responsible for distributing FM200 gas from the pipeline system to the environment, helping to extinguish fires quickly and effectively.
An FM200 nozzle usually has a fairly simple structure, including:
- Nozzle body: usually made of heat-resistant, high-pressure resistant material.
- Nozzle holes: Tiny holes are specially designed to disperse FM200 gas evenly.
- Flange: Used to connect to the pipeline.
Controller
The controller in the FM200 fire extinguishing system is the central device, acting as the "brain" to manage and activate the system when a fire is detected. The controller is responsible for receiving signals from sensors and fire alarm systems, then sending commands to activate the FM200 gas cylinder to discharge gas through the pipeline system and sprinkler heads, helping to ensure the system operates promptly, accurately and effectively to control the fire quickly.
The structure of a controller usually includes:
- Motherboard: is the control center, processes information and makes decisions.
- The power source helps provide energy to the controller and other devices in the system.
- The communication port is used to connect to sensors, fire detectors, gas release valves and other peripherals.
- The screen displays information about the operating status of the system, problems and warnings.
- Keyboard to set up, adjust and check the system.
Fire alarm devices
Some common fire alarm devices today include:
- Smoke detectors help detect smoke from burning materials, helping to identify fires at an early stage, before the fire breaks out.
- Heat detectors help detect abnormal increases in temperature, especially effective in environments without much smoke but prone to generating large amounts of heat when a fire occurs.
- Emergency switches allow users to activate the manual fire extinguishing system in case of early fire detection.
- Fire alarm bells help to emit sound signals (bells) and light (lights) to warn people in the area when there is a fire.
- Fire alarm cabinets are responsible for connecting and controlling the operation of fire alarm devices, helping the system operate synchronously and activate fire extinguishing when detecting fire signals from alarm devices.
Operating principle of FM200 syzstem
Fire detection process
Sensors: smoke detectors, heat detectors, will continuously monitor the surrounding environment. When detecting abnormal signs such as smoke, high temperature, or toxic gas concentration exceeding the allowable threshold, these devices will send an alarm signal to the controller.
When the sensors detect fire, the signal will be transmitted to the central controller via a wired or wireless system.
System activation process
These signals will be sent to the central controller for analysis and evaluation. To avoid false alarms, the controller can request two or more simultaneous fire alarm signals or confirmation from multiple devices (smoke detectors and heat detectors), commonly known as dual signal confirmation. When all confirmation conditions are met, the controller will activate the warning phase.
The controller activates alarm devices, including fire alarms, and an audio announcement system to warn and instruct people to evacuate the hazardous area.
The system will wait for a short delay (depending on the system configuration) before releasing the gas. This time allows staff or residents time to safely evacuate the area.
FM200 gas discharge and fire suppression
After the evacuation period is over, the controller will send a signal to the gas discharge valve of the FM200 tank. The valve will open and allow FM200 gas to enter the piping system, ready to be released through the nozzles to extinguish the fire. FM200 gas will be evenly distributed through the nozzles, creating a gas layer covering the entire fire area.
FM200 absorbs heat from the fire quickly, reducing the oxygen concentration in the fire area, causing the fire to no longer have enough oxygen to maintain the fire. But FM200 does not completely suffocate, so it does not seriously affect human health if the gas concentration is low.
FM200 contains chemical compounds that can interrupt the chemical reaction chain of the fire. The gas molecules directly affect the fire, slowing down the burning process and quickly extinguishing the fire. After confirming that the fire has been extinguished, the area needs to be ventilated to remove the remaining FM200 gas.
Outstanding advantages of the FM200 system compared to other gases
Advantages
- FM200 gas has the ability to extinguish fires quickly and effectively, especially for class A, B, C fires.
- This gas is non-toxic, non-conductive and does not leave any residue after use, ensuring safety for people in the area.
- The potential for ozone depletion is very low and the greenhouse effect is low, environmentally friendly. No residue or waste left after spraying, saving time and money for cleaning and restoring the space after fire fighting
- Does not damage electronic equipment, machinery and other objects.
- FM200 systems can be installed in many different types of spaces, from computer rooms, data storage rooms to clean rooms...
Disadvantages
- The initial investment cost is quite high compared to other fire extinguishing systems.
- FM200 systems need regular maintenance to ensure stable and effective operation.
- Environmental impact (very low level)
- Not effective for all types of metal fires.
Common applications of FM200 systems
FM200 fire extinguishing systems have many outstanding advantages, so they are widely used in many different fields. Here are some specific applications:
- Data center: the system helps protect electronic devices, servers, network systems from damage due to fire and explosion with the ability to quickly extinguish fires without affecting high-tech equipment.
- Control room: protect central control devices, control panels, other electronic devices from damage.
- Protect products, equipment in clean rooms from contamination by fire extinguishing agents.
- Protect important documents, libraries and museums such as artifacts, precious documents and other valuable objects.
- Protect medical equipment, sensitive electronic equipment from damage to ensure the safety of patients and medical staff.
- Ensure safety for chemical plants, warehouses containing flammable chemicals.
- Protect high floors of buildings, places that are difficult to access by conventional fire fighting means.
